Freelancing in a work environment is characterized by the way an individual operates independently rather than being tied to a structured action plan or specific project outlined by an employer or organization. This type of work arrangement allows freelancers the flexibility to choose which projects to take on, when to work, and often from where to work. Choosing to operate outside of a formal action plan means that the freelancer manages their own workflow and timelines, making independent decisions about their tasks and responsibilities.

While group dynamics and awareness of tasks can be beneficial in collaborative environments, these elements do not specifically define what freelancing is. Freelancers typically work autonomously, thus emphasizing the importance of flexibility and self-direction that distinguishes this work style from traditional employment structures.
